Product details
Wireless controller for an enhanced gaming experience on the Nintendo Switch, Lite, and OLED, perfect for TV and tabletop mode. Dual vibration with two motors for a realistic gaming feel. A cool wireless controller that is the ideal complement to the Nintendo Switch, Lite, and OLED, allowing you to game like a pro. Easy pairing with the console via Bluetooth, making it also usable on PC. Compact gamepad with standard-sized buttons and controls. 3-level adjustable vibration. 4 additional programmable buttons on the back of the controller that can be assigned single commands or entire combinations. 2 shoulder buttons and 2 trigger buttons. Directional pad with 8 movement directions. Screenshot function. 2 analog sticks with button functionality. Turbo fire function. Up to 15 hours of gaming fun on a single battery charge.
